Microsoft Hyper-V Server: Microsoft Hyper-V Server is a free, standalone product that provides a hypervisor-based virtualization platform for running virtual machines on x64 Windows servers. It has a small footprint and basic management tools.

Notice: Notice is a communication and collaboration platform for teams. It allows users to have discussions, share files and links, make announcements, and manage projects. Notice aims to streamline team communication in a simple interface.
